POV Snow removal and drift control with Doosan DL250 after a large blizzard came through. Im working with a sidewalk crew with snowrators and a bobcat L28 with snow blower attachment to clear 3-5ft drifts off of the sidewalk at this facility. High winds at this building create really bad drifts on one side so we come out every few hours to keep these under control until it dies down and we can salt. The building had really bad designing in this aspect and the client is aware of this as well. It may seem like a lot of snow to have down at a time but this is the solution we came up with working with the client to be as budget friendly and employee friendly(on our end not having guys sit there for days on end) as possible. The doorways and main entrances are constantly monitored so foot traffic can still get out and the parking lots never really get affected so we are able to keep those ares safe all the time. Towards the end I threw on some footage at this same facility of the Doosan 250 loading out the massive snow piles we had all over this facility once the winds subsided and blizzard had passed. We had about 20 trucks and two loaders running for 2 nights to get this hauled out. We haul this facility out every snow fall because of limited space and truck traffic.
